The Adoption Transition: Once Your Child is Home-- Fond du Lac
Saturday, February 27 2010, 9:00am - 12:00pm
by  This e-mail address is being protected from spambots. You need JavaScript enabled to view it Hits : 330

Audience: Families adopting internationally


Once the euphoria of arriving home and the congratulations from family and friends ends, what’s next?  This workshop provides insight into preparing for what to do and expect after bringing your child home.  Topics include legal requirements, adjusting as a family, advocating for your child, talking about adoption, and adoption in the schools.
